Spacewaves and the Search for Extraterrestrial Intelligence
The boundlessness of space has long captivated humanity's imagination, inspiring us to ponder the possibility of life beyond our planet. Scientists|Astronomers|Researchers tirelessly monitor the cosmos, searching for evidence of extraterrestrial intelligence (SETI). One primary method involves decoding radio signals, known as spacewaves, which could potentially emanate from advanced civilizations. The detection of even a single artificial signal would revolutionize our understanding of the universe and confirm that we are not alone.
